Passive Reconnaissance and Tool Usage Notes

Passive Recon

  • As we already know, the goal of recon is to find more about information about our target. This can include network info, systems, applications, and other technical and organizational information. This brings us into the methods to obtain this information including passive recon. Passive recon involves not directly interacting with the target but rather making use of existing databases and information on the internet in order to gather info. This usually involves utilizing google search and interacting with publicly known databases in order to complete this passive recon. There are also tools developed to help with passive reconnaissance such as Theharvester and netcraft, and other miscellaneous tools. The main point to understand is that the difference between passive and active recon is directly interacting with the target.

Tool Usage

  • A small footnote in this lesson was the trust of tools, understanding where they come from and ensuring that they were developed to help you and not obtain information for a malicious source. By understanding the source of your tools as well as exactly what they do and all of your capabilities, you can avoid issues when blindly running tools.
